Post Secondary Student Support
The Post Secondary Student Support Program, administered by the Peter Ballantyne Cree Nation (PBCN), is dedicated to fulfilling Treaty obligations by supporting Treaty status Indians in their pursuit of postsecondary education. By providing assistance, the program aims to equip its members with the qualifications and skills necessary for individual careers and contributing to Indian Self-Government.
Many youth from the PBCN go on to attend various educational institutions across Saskatchewan, including the University of Saskatchewan, University of Regina, and First Nations University of Canada. Through its mission, the program emphasizes the importance of education in fostering personal and community development.
